Why my fellow marketing professionals should not fear the AI 

In an era where artificial intelligence (AI) is rapidly transforming industries, the marketing landscape is undergoing a significant shift. Recent findings from Semrush*, based on an analysis of 8,000 content marketing job listings in the United States, reveal intriguing insights into the evolving demands for marketing professionals. The data indicates a striking increase in demand for certain roles within the content marketing sector. Notably, job listings for “Content Producer” positions have skyrocketed by an astonishing 1,261%. This surge suggests that organizations are prioritizing the creation of high-quality, engaging content that resonates with their audiences. As businesses increasingly recognize the importance of content in driving consumer engagement and brand loyalty, the role of the Content Producer becomes crucial. Their ability to craft compelling narratives, manage content workflows, and oversee production processes are pivotal in a market that values creativity and strategic execution.

Moreover, the demand for senior positions, such as “Head of Content Marketing,” has also seen a remarkable increase of 376%. This trend signals a shift towards more strategic oversight in content creation and distribution. Senior roles are now tasked with not only managing teams but also aligning content strategies with broader marketing objectives. As organizations navigate the complexities of digital marketing, the need for experienced leaders who can integrate innovative content approaches with business goals becomes paramount.

Interestingly, while AI skills are becoming increasingly relevant, they do not top the list of hiring priorities. The data reveals that 34% of senior roles mention AI expertise, compared to only 20% in execution-level positions. This indicates that while familiarity with AI tools and technologies is valuable, it is not yet the primary focus for many employers. Instead, the emphasis remains on execution—delivering results through effective content strategies, which include understanding audience behavior, optimizing content for various platforms, and leveraging analytics.

Analytics emerges as the number one skill for senior roles, underscoring the necessity for marketers to interpret data effectively. The ability to analyze performance metrics, understand audience insights, and adapt strategies accordingly is critical in an age where data-driven decision-making is the norm.
